Output f901d7672644d64ffcd0f701651b7285de3881788aca0bfa865f74a6b9ec8aae:5

value
30733796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ba04e2db0fd7803763bb7e09a79dce84c39ae4e OP_EQUAL
address
35fh21HxKenLunf5zHBevkf4S2Y7w6ke1g
transaction
f901d7672644d64ffcd0f701651b7285de3881788aca0bfa865f74a6b9ec8aae
spent
true